It's my first time re-packing the stern gland which I took it apart this afternoon. I already had pre-cut rings of new packing ready to go. On undoing the packing nut, and removal of the shaft - I found no packing material, even after digging around. Is this normal? The nut illustrated has a rubber washer inside it. I also show a photo of the stern gland incase a forumite my recognises my system. Could the old packing have worn to nothing? Is this a packing-less system? Any suggestions welcome as I am not really sure what to do now.

It sounds as though a previous owner has replaced the original packing with an O-ring. I would pull the O-ring out and insert as many rings of packing as you can get in. Don't forget to offset the joints in the rings.
